Features and Functionality

The Donner Electronic Drum Set comes with seven drum pads that replicate real drum sounds, including snare, crash, ride, hi-hat, and toms. It includes a built-in speaker and offers volume adjustments across nine levels. Additionally, it features MIDI connectivity, allowing users to connect to computers for music production. Conversely, the Zshion bumper is a stainless steel protective case designed to safeguard the Casio G-Shock watch from scratches and dents. It maintains easy access to all watch functions, highlighting practicality over versatility.

Design and Build Quality

The Donner Electronic Drum Set is made from high-quality soft silicone, which allows for quiet drumming sessions. It is designed to be rolled up for easy storage, enhancing its portability. On the other hand, the Zshion bumper is constructed from durable stainless steel, ensuring that it can withstand everyday wear and tear. While the Donner focuses on a user-friendly design suitable for practice, the Zshion emphasizes sturdiness and longevity, catering to the needs of watch users.
